""Spiritual Maladies offers a helpful survey of holistic healing (body, soul, and spirit) in Scripture that is informed by perspectives from the early church fathers of the Eastern Church. Bourguet challenges Western Christian theologies that overemphasize God as judge and sin as transgression, integrating a therapeutic use of the law with a robust presentation of God as healer and sin as sickness. Bourguet presents God's treatment of Cain's anger as a case study in a way that models the integration of careful exegesis and contemplative insight at the service of pastoral care. His final chapter on the Eastern Christian understanding of the eight mortal passions is a valuable introduction to the diagnosis and treatment of spiritual maladies that will serve anyone engaged in holistic liberation.""

Daniel Bourguet has been a pastor in the French Reformed Church. He has exercised a range of ministries in the local church and in theological institutions. Hecurrently leads a contemplative life that involves prayer and writing; he also conducts retreats and receives visitors.
